Функція VBA EOF

Опис EOF

Повертає значення, яке вказує, чи досягнуто кінця файлу (логічне значення).

Синтаксис EOF

У редакторі VBA ви можете ввести "EOF (", щоб побачити синтаксис функції EOF:

Функція EOF містить аргумент:

Номер файлу: Будь -який дійсний номер файлу.

Приклади функцій Excel VBA EOF

Щоб перевірити функцію EOF, створіть текстовий файл «test.txt» на диску D. (D: \ test.txt) Припустимо, що вміст файлу такий.

123 abc1 2 3xy z

Будь ласка, запустіть наступний код.

1234567891011 Sub Input_Fx_Example ()Dim strContent As StringDim MyCharВідкрийте "D: \ test.txt" Для введення як #1 "Відкрийте файл.Do While Not EOF (1) 'Цикл до кінця файлу.MyChar = Input (1, #1) 'Отримайте один символ.strContent = strContent & MyChar 'ПетляMsgBox strContentЗакрити #1 'Закрити файл.End Sub

Тоді результат буде таким.

Тут використовується функція EOF для визначення того, що кінець файлу досягнутий.

Ви допоможете розвитку сайту, поділившись сторінкою з друзями

wave wave wave wave wave